Motorcyclist in Bohmte seriously injured after collision with tractor trailer

Today there was a serious accident in Bohmte, in the Osnabrück district, which attracted the public's attention. A motorcyclist, born in 1998, collided with a tractor trailer and suffered life-threatening injuries. The incident occurred when the biker accelerated sharply behind a roundabout in a left-hand bend on Federal Highway 65 and crashed into the trailer. Fortunately, the tractor driver was unharmed.

The injured motorcyclist was immediately taken to hospital. As the Time Reportedly, the accident happened around 9:10 p.m. At this point it is still unclear what exact circumstances led to this tragic incident. The police have started an investigation to fully clarify what happened to the accident.

A look at the current traffic situation

Similar tragic accidents are not uncommon. Another incident that recently occurred on Federal Highway 87 caused tempers to run high. A motorcyclist died after colliding with a tractor, causing both vehicles to burst into flames. The fire department deployed eight vehicles to extinguish the fire. Here too, the 85-year-old tractor driver remained physically unharmed, while the fatally injured motorcyclist has not yet been identified. The daily news reported that the federal highway was completely closed until late Wednesday evening due to the rescue work.

A general look at road safety in Germany shows that the numbers have been reduced in recent years, but accidents caused by motorcycles are still a big issue. According to the Motor newspaper There were a total of 2,780 traffic deaths in Germany in 2024, which corresponds to a decrease of around 2 percent compared to the previous year. Nevertheless, the number of injured motorcyclists remains alarmingly high, and it is apparent that younger motorcyclists in particular are often affected by serious accidents.
